Sourdough Bread



Sourdough bread, renowned for its distinct tangy flavor and crunchy structure, is an ageless standard that has actually been valued for centuries. Coming from as a staple in old human beings, this artisanal bread owes its one-of-a-kind qualities to the all-natural fermentation process including wild yeast and lactic acid bacteria. The absence of commercial yeast permits a slower fermentation, which improves the depth of flavor and causes an extra digestible loaf.


The standard method of making sourdough starts with a starter, a mixture of flour and water that captures wild yeast from the setting. This starter is thoroughly maintained and fed routinely to keep the yeast and microorganisms energetic. When introduced to dough, the starter launches fermentation, creating bubbles of co2 that give the bread its airy structure. The prolonged fermentation duration not only enhances the texture but additionally breaks down gluten and phytic acid, making sourdough more nutritious and simpler on the gastrointestinal system.

Baguettes





Though commonly associated with the cooking practices of France, baguettes have actually become a beloved staple in pastry shops around the globe. Recognizable by their elongated form and crisp, golden-brown crust, baguettes are often considered the embodiment of simple, yet splendid, bread-making (Cafe Shop). The beginnings of the baguette in its modern type can be traced back to the early 20th century, when improvements in baking technology permitted the creation of this distinct loaf


At its core, a typical baguette consists of just four ingredients: flour, water, yeast, and salt. The dough undergoes a thorough procedure of massaging, proofing, and cooking, which results in its characteristic structure-- a thin, crackly crust enveloping a soft, airy interior.

Croissants



Distinguished for their buttery, half-cracked layers, croissants stand as a quintessential symbol of French bread workmanship. Stemming from Austria however perfected in France, croissants are a staple in patisseries and bakeries worldwide (Lofology Bakery And Cafe). Their manufacturing involves a precise procedure referred to as lamination, where dough is folded up with butter several times to develop thin layers that expand beautifully when baked


The trick to an excellent croissant exists in the quality of active ingredients and the accuracy of strategy. The dough must be taken care of naturally to preserve the integrity of the layers, making certain an airy, light interior.


Croissants can be taken pleasure in simple or filled with a selection of ingredients such as almond paste, delicious chocolate, or ham and cheese, using flexibility to suit various tastes. Brioche



Brioche's abundant history and luxurious appearance make it a standout worldwide of bread and pastries. Originating from France, this sweet, buttery bread go back to at least the 15th century and has given that come to be a sign of indulgence and cooking skill. Its name, derived from the Old French term "brier," suggesting to knead, highlights the value of strategy in its preparation.


The trick to brioche's distinct character lies in its enriched dough, which is loaded with eggs and butter, resulting in a tender crumb and a golden, half-cracked crust. It can be delighted in plain, toasted with a touch of jam, or utilized as the base for even more intricate productions such as brioche à tête, hamburger buns, or even bread pudding.


Regardless of its seemingly straightforward components, the art of crafting a perfect brioche needs precision and patience. The dough undertakes a meticulous procedure of working, resting, and proofing, making sure that each loaf achieves its characteristic lightness and richness.
